15 Sphynx cat disasters, that require quick veterinary consultation and/or treatment:

  • Unrestrained blood loss or bleeding which doesn’t stop within 5 minutes
  • Alterations in breathing, lack of breath or nonstop coughing and/or gagging
  • Lack of ability to urinate or pass feces (stool)
  • Blood in urine/stool
  • Any injuries to your cat’s eye(s) or unexpected loss of sight
  • Ingestion of something toxic
  • Loss of stability or seizures
  • Lack of ability to move
  • Fractured bones or significant lameness
  • Severe panic and anxiety
  • Heatstroke
  • Uncontrolled nausea or diarrhea (more than two attacks in 24 hours)
  • Refusal to drink or eat for 24 hours or more
  • Unconsciousness/coma
  • Penetrating injuries, heavy lacerations or holes

Other situations enable you to plan your visit to the veterinary center essentially with no hurry.
